释义

Fame is the state of being widely known and recognized by many people, usually because of talent, success, or media attention.

用法与细微差别

Usually uncountable: say 'achieve fame' or 'rise to fame', not usually 'a fame'. Often used for public recognition, and it can be positive, glamorous, or sometimes stressful. Common phrases: 'instant fame', 'international fame', 'claim to fame'.
